As a Software Engineer on our Collections team, you will be responsible for building and maintaining the core infrastructure of our product. You will work closely with our design and product teams to understand the needs of our users and develop solutions that meet those needs. This is a unique opportunity to work on a high-impact project that will shape the future of our product.
Key Responsibilities:
- Design and implement scalable and efficient data storage solutions using Python and AWS.
- Collaborate with cross-functional teams to develop and maintain the core infrastructure of our product.
- Develop and maintain high-quality, well-tested code using Node.js and Python.
- Work closely with our design and product teams to understand user needs and develop solutions that meet those needs.
- Contribute to the development of new features and improvements to existing ones.
Requirements:
- 3+ years of experience in software engineering, with a focus on data storage and infrastructure.
- Strong understanding of Python, Node.js, and AWS.
- Experience with machine learning and data analysis a plus.
- Excellent communication and collaboration skills.
- Ability to work in a fast-paced environment and prioritize tasks effectively.